Find the slope of the line which passes through the points (-5, 1) and (2,-4).

Respuesta :

jimrgrant1 jimrgrant1
  • 15-09-2021

Answer:

slope = - [tex]\frac{5}{7}[/tex]

Step-by-step explanation:

Calculate the slope m using the slope formula

m = [tex]\frac{y_{2}-y_{1} }{x_{2}-x_{1} }[/tex]

with (x₁, y₁ ) = (- 5, 1) and (x₂, y₂ ) = (2, - 4)

m = [tex]\frac{-4-1}{2-(-5)}[/tex] = [tex]\frac{-5}{2+5}[/tex] = [tex]\frac{-5}{7}[/tex] = - [tex]\frac{5}{7}[/tex]
